Facts 

Overview
Through truss bridge over Lamine River on the Katy Trail (Missouri-Kansas-Texas Railroad)
Location
Cooper County, Missouri
Status
Open to pedestrians and bicyclists on the Katy Trail
History
Built 1909-10 by the King Bridge Co. of Cleveland, Ohio, replacing an earlier wooden trestle
Builder
- King Bridge Co. of Cleveland, Ohio
Design
Pin-connected, 7-panel Camelback Pratt through truss with a deck plate girder approach
